A Zerol bevel gear is a spiral bevel gear with a zero-degree spiral angle. It combines features of straight and spiral gears.
They offer smooth, quiet operation like spiral gears but without axial thrust. They are also less sensitive to misalignment than straight bevel gears.
They are used in machine tools, printing presses, and aerospace equipment where quiet, high-speed operation is needed, often replacing straight bevel gears.
Straight bevel gears are conical gears with straight teeth that transmit motion and torque between intersecting shafts—most often at 90°. They are simple, accurate, and cost-effective for moderate speeds and loads. Compared with spiral bevel gears, they are easier to manufacture but generate more noise and vibration at higher speeds. Typical materials include alloy and carbon steels, finished by cutting, heat treatment, and grinding. Common uses: machinery right-angle drives, agricultural equipment, tools, and reducers where precise alignment and compact layouts are required.

Quick comparison for selection and application guidance.
| Dimension | Straight Bevel | Spiral Bevel |
|---|---|---|
| Tooth form | Straight teeth | Curved (spiral) teeth |
| Shaft angle | Typically 90° (customizable) | Typically 90° (customizable) |
| Noise / Vibration | Higher, especially at high speed | Lower; smoother operation |
| Load capacity & life | Moderate | Higher |
| Machining difficulty / Cost | Lower; simpler to manufacture | Higher; more expensive |
| Alignment & assembly | More sensitive to coaxiality/center distance | More forgiving assembly tolerances |
| Typical applications | Agricultural machinery, tools, low-to-medium speed gearboxes | Automotive differentials, high-speed machinery |

Wenlio Gear’s bevel and miter gears turn power between shafts that meet at 90°.
Ratios: Miter gears are 1:1. Bevel gears range from 1.5:1 to 6:1.
Tooth design: Usually 20° pressure angle. A long/short addendum is used to avoid undercut on small tooth counts.
Matching rules (Miters): They only work together when tooth count, pitch, and pressure angle are the same. You can use more than two in one system (e.g., a differential).
Matching rules (Bevels): Sold as matched gear–pinion pairs. Do not mix different pitch, pressure angle, or ratio. When one is worn, replace the whole pair, especially for low ratios.

1: High Transmission Accuracy
Our involute gears offer a precise and constant transmission ratio. This is not only critical for precision machinery and instruments but also essential for reducing dynamic loads and achieving smooth operation, especially under high-speed and heavy-load conditions.
2: Wide Range of Applications
Gear drives can transmit a vast range of power, from as little as 0.001W up to 60,000kW. They can operate at very low speeds or at high speeds up to 150 m/s, a performance level that is unmatched by belt or chain drives.
3: Versatile Axis Arrangements
Our gears can connect and transmit power between parallel, intersecting, and crossed shafts. This flexibility is a key advantage that other transmission methods like belt and chain drives cannot achieve.
4: Long Service Life and High Efficiency
Designed for durability, these gears provide a long lifespan and maintain high transmission efficiency, reducing power loss and operational costs.
5: Strict Environmental Requirements
To ensure optimal performance and longevity, gears generally require a housing or gearbox to protect them from dust and debris. Proper lubrication is also essential, except in a few low-speed, low-precision applications.
